Variation of betaine, <i>N,N-</i>dimethylglycine, choline, glycerophosphorylcholine, taurine and trimethylamine-<i>N</i>-oxide in the plasma and urine of overweight people with type 2 diabetes over a two-year period

Abstract

Betaine is highly individual in overweight people with diabetes. Betaine, its metabolite DMG, and precursor choline showed more reliability than the osmolytes, GPC and taurine. The low reliability of TMAO suggests that a single TMAO measurement has low diagnostic value.
